I reviewed the draft and support WG adoption.

I believe this ELP PCE  capability extension maybe helpful in determining
the position to place the ELI. EL label.  According to RFC 8662 a {ELI,EL}
label must be placed after every SID in the sid list based on the ERLD.  I
maybe a good idea to explain why computing the ERLD would add complexity in
the ELI/EL insertion process and why a new mechanism using the ELP is
necessary.  Also why the ERLD computation is not required as described in
RFC 8662.
